      Sweden's Tax Authority Demands $56 Million from Crypto Miners for Invalid Tax Breaks

      Sweden's tax authority, Skatteverket, has issued demands totaling approximately $56.5 million against six cryptocurrency mining companies based in Boden, a city in northern Sweden known for its energy-intensive computing operations. This enforcement action is part of a broader audit that spans from 2024 to 2026, targeting nine companies across the country for alleged tax violations related to their operational structures and reporting practices.

      The mining firms are accused of improperly claiming tax incentives intended for conventional data centers, as well as value-added tax (VAT) deductions, despite not meeting the necessary criteria outlined in Swedish law. Regulators assert that these companies constructed their corporate frameworks to appear eligible for these benefits when they were not, contributing to an estimated $100 million in lost revenue for Sweden's public finances due to discrepancies in crypto mining taxes.

      Among the companies involved is Bikupan Datacenter, the Swedish subsidiary of HIVE Digital Technologies, which has appealed its assessment to Sweden's Supreme Administrative Court. The CEO of Bikupan, Johanna Törnblad, contends that the company should not be classified as a mining operation, arguing that it merely provided computing resources while independent pools conducted the actual mining. HIVE has recognized an $84.7 million non-cash provision related to its VAT disputes in Sweden, significantly impacting its financial standing and prompting a shift in focus towards artificial intelligence and high-performance computing.

      This multi-year audit and the ongoing legal battles signal a significant institutional approach to regulating the crypto mining sector in Sweden. The outcome of the Supreme Administrative Court case involving Bikupan is expected to influence how tax claims related to cryptocurrency mining are handled in the future, potentially affecting investors in publicly traded mining companies with exposure in Europe.
